RECREATIONAL EXPERIENCES ACHIEVING COMMUNITY HARMONY INC, founded in 2000, is a small nonprofit in the Youth Development sector that reported $233K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 45%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ring.

Mission

To provide learning and leadership through youth-adult partnerships in Carlton County.
